San Diego Miramar College is in San Diego, CA.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 89 biomedical technology degrees were granted at San Diego Miramar College.

Online Class Availability at San Diego Miramar College

Many students take online classes at San Diego Miramar College. Among 14,257 students, 5,369 (38%) studied exclusively online and 2,437 (17%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the student demographics for Biomedical Technology graduates at San Diego Miramar College, broken down by degree level.

Across all degree levels, Biomedical Technology graduates at San Diego Miramar College are 70% women (62) and 30% men (27).

Biomedical Technology Associate’s Program at San Diego Miramar College

Among the 66 associate’s biomedical technology graduates at San Diego Miramar College, 71% were women (47) and 29% were men (19).

San Diego Miramar College gender breakdown of Biomedical Technology Associate's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Biomedical Technology associate’s degree recipients at San Diego Miramar College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 15
Hispanic / Latino 16
Black / African American 3
Asian 27
Two or More Races 3
International (Nonresident) 1
Unknown 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of Biomedical Technology majors at San Diego Miramar College

Minority students account for 74% of Biomedical Technology associate’s degree recipients at San Diego Miramar College, higher than the national average of 44%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
